OnPay is a payroll solution mainly used by small businesses in industries like accounting, banking, and nonprofit management. It’s most valued for simplifying payroll processing and offering self-service onboarding. Users highlight its reporting tools and accounting integrations as differentiators. Drawbacks include limited leave tracking and occasional tax filing issues.

Overall, it worked for us with the transparent pricing and predictable costs. Very easy to use and we wanted something you can get up and running quickly. It handles payroll across a few states, but I don’t need a huge enterprise HR/Pay ecosystem.
Pros: The setup is quick and painless, the interface is intuitive, and it doesn’t take tons of training to get going. It supports unlimited monthly pay runs for W-2 employees and 1099 contractors, handles multi-state payroll, direct deposit/check/debit card payments. Great customer support, especially during onboarding. Great fit for small businesses. Good value with a set base price.
Cons: While it integrates with accounting/time tools, the number of integrations is fewer than many competitors. Also, there isn’t a strong native mobile app for employers. For companies that need robust timeclock, scheduling, or job-costing features built into payroll, OnPay might require external tools.
